It was eleven acts’ chance at a second rehearsal at this year’s Eurovision. Some were singing for redemption after a weak first rehearsal. For others, it was just another day in the office, proving that their package is ready and raring to go next week.

On May 10 of Eurovision 2019 rehearsals, 11 acts took to the stage again. With another chance to tighten up their performances, which of them managed to nail their rehearsal and move towards the Eurovision final?

We want to know which of those 11 countries had your favourite second rehearsal. Was it Greece, San Marino, Armenia, Ireland, Moldova, Switzerland, Latvia, Romania, Denmark, Sweden or Austria? You can let us know your thoughts in our poll!
